> wouldn't it be an interesting idea to have some feature/switch in
> rsync, which can globally (on a per host basis) turn rsync
> into "read-only" mode, i.e. which makes rsync binary drop any
> capability of using write/modify/delete syscalls ?
> ...
> ...

1. Does the (default) "read only" module parameter not suffice?

2. Isn't the usual way to achieve the same global effect simply to run
the utlilty under a UID that has no write permissions?
